The modernization of the hydroelectric power plants of Elektroprivreda Srbije continues, and after the work done in the HPPs Bajina Basta, Zvornik and Djerdap 1, the renovation of the Vlasina HPPs will soon begin. The contract for the reconstruction and modernization of the Vlasina HPPs was signed yesterday by Dusan Zivkovic, General Manager of Elektroprivreda Srbije, and representatives of the contractor Energotehnika Juzna Backa. – On the day when the Vlasina HPPs are celebrating 70 years of operation, we are officially beginning the project of their modernization, which will increase the installed capacity by eight megawatts and ensure their more reliable operation in the next three to four decades. This is a new, extended life for the veteran of the hydro sector of EPS – said Zivkovic.


He reminded that the Vlasina HPPs were unique power plants in the EPS portfolio that operated in a cascade system and that, by producing energy four times in a row, represented a significant source of “peak” energy.

– The total value of the project is EUR 109.7 million and envisages the reconstruction and modernization of production units, auxiliary systems and hydromechanical equipment. The suppliers of the main equipment of the units, namely turbines and generators, will be renowned global companies, Andritz Hydro and Gamesa Electric – said Zivkovic.

Financing will be realized through a loan from the European Bank for Reconstruction and Development (EBRD) in the amount of EUR 67 million, the European Union has provided grants in the amount of EUR 15.43 million through the Western Balkans Investment Framework (WBIF), while the remaining funds of EUR 27.26 million will be provided by EPS.

The signing of the contract was attended by Milan Aleksic, Advisor to the Minister of Mining and Energy for Capital Projects, and Francesco Corbo, Regional Head Energy Europe for the Western Balkans and Croatia, EBRD.

– In the face of climate and technological challenges, our obligation is to modernize the existing production capacities. Investments are the key to what we need to do in the coming years to ensure a secure supply of electricity, in the face of growing demand and the need to rely more on renewable energy sources. The project to reconstruct the Vlasina HPPs is an important step in that direction. With this investment, we are extending the operating life of the power plant, thus continuing the tradition of the plant that has been reliably contributing to energy security for more than 70 years – said Aleksic.

He thanked the European Union for its support for the project and stated that, with the support of the EU, the modernization of the Potpec and Bistrica hydropower plants would also be implemented.

The Vlasina HPPs began operation on November 6, 1955, with the commissioning of the first unit in the Vrla 1 HPP. The system consists of the Vlasina reservoir, four diversion hydropower plants in a cascade, and the Lisina pumping station with the reservoir of the same name. Since the start of operation, the 129 MW power plants have produced more than 17 million GWh of green electricity.

Vlasinsko jezero je akumulaciono jezero na jugoistoku Srbije sa površinom od 15 km? i dubinom do 35 m. Jezero se nalazi na području opštine Surdulica. Jezero se nalazi na 1.204 m (srednji nivo) nadmorske visine. Na obalama jezera smeštena su tri sela: Vlasina Okruglica, Vlasina Rid i Vlasina Stojkovićeva. Vlasinsko jezero je obrazovano u razdoblju 1949—1954. godine.

Na mestu gde se danas nalazi Vlasinsko jezero u prošlosti se nalazila tresava, poznata kao Vlasinsko blato, sa ševarom, trskom i samo mestimičnim vodenim površinama, iz koje je izvirala reka Vlasina.

Istorijski zapisi koji spominju Vlasinsku visoravan potiču još od 18. veka pod nazivom Vlasinsko blato ili Vlasinska tresava zbog nagomilanog treseta i blata nastalog spiranjem rečnih tokova. Na taj način je u kanjonu dugom 20 km stvorena močvara koja je na pojedinim mestima bila ispunjena živim peskom.

Izgradnja jezerske brane trajala je od 1946. do 1949. godine na položaju nekadašnjeg Vlasinskog blata. Jezero je počelo da se puni 9. aprila 1949. godine, da bi 1954. dostiglo puni kapacitet - 165 miliona kubnih metara vode.

Posle izgradnje jezera trećina jezera je bila pod „plovećim ostrvima“, zapravo delovima treseta, koji se otkinuo sa novoobrazovanog dna jezera. U početku su data ostrva namenski vezivana za obalu, da bi se od sredine 1970-ih godina uočila njihova jedinstvenost. Danas postoji nekoliko „plovećih ostrva“. (Wikipedia)
